Output 39baef8410fb05f09795745e9b9e4132e0c20e1bfee286f61823357458fcd822:3

value
29971374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852675618541212ce1ef69c18dbec46b676de95c OP_EQUAL
address
3Dq3sCfffYpLr1t9SNevGvbfQqDqbvHzSe
transaction
39baef8410fb05f09795745e9b9e4132e0c20e1bfee286f61823357458fcd822
spent
true